## Idempotency Keys for Payment Retries (Lumopay)

Every retry of a charge request must reuse the original idempotency key; generating a new key on retry can produce duplicate charges. Keys are scoped per merchant and expire after 48 hours. Reviewers should verify keys are derived server-side, never from client input. The full key-generation specification and threat model are maintained on the internal page.

dashboard of kaguf-tawip = https://vault.merlaqsys.test/issue

Handover note — dock deliveries. Hi Marit, while I'm out, deliveries at the Velstrand Building loading dock run 07:30–11:00 and 13:00–15:30, weekdays only. Couriers buzz the dock intercom; sign anything under 20 kg yourself, otherwise call facilities. The roller door stays locked between windows, so late drivers must wait or rebook. Perishables for the Fenwick team go straight to the third-floor fridge. To open the dock side door, use the pass code below.

door code, yagap-bahof: bdg-O-05

### RestockPilot: Release Prerequisites

Before cutting a release, confirm that the RestockPilot planner can reach the SnackGrid inventory service, since the build pipeline runs an integration smoke test against staging during packaging. A failed handshake here blocks the release tag, so verify credentials first. The pipeline reads its staging credential from the deploy config; for reference and manual verification, the current key appears below.

service key, tajof-fawip: vxb4-JNOz